When selecting and installing tiles for your home, it’s essential to consider a few practical aspects to ensure a smooth process and satisfactory results. Here are some important points to keep in mind:
• Color Shade Variations: Expect Variations, even if you order the same type and brand of tiles, slight variations in color shade are common. These differences can occur due to manufacturing processes and batch production. To minimize noticeable differences, it’s advisable to order all tiles for a specific area from the same batch. Always inspect the tiles before installation to ensure the color shades are consistent and match your expectations.
• Construction Wastage: Plan for Extra, when calculating the number of tiles you need, it’s important to account for construction wastage. On average, you should plan for an additional 5% to 10% of tiles to cover cutting errors, breakages, and future repairs. This extra stock also ensures that you have tiles from the same batch, which is crucial for maintaining a consistent look.
• Handling Broken Edges: Quality and Handling Issues. Tiles can suffer from broken edges due to various reasons such as poor packaging, rough handling during loading and unloading, or mishandling during transportation. Always inspect tiles upon delivery and report any damages immediately. Consider purchasing from reputable suppliers who ensure quality packaging and careful handling to reduce the risk of receiving damaged tiles.
• Advance Order Time: Order Ahead tiles, especially those with specific designs or sizes, might not always be readily available. It’s wise to place your order at least one month in advance to ensure timely delivery. This lead time allows for potential delays and gives you the flexibility to handle any unexpected issues, such as incorrect orders or the need for additional tiles. These practical considerations are crucial for ensuring the successful installation of tiles in your home, helping to avoid common pitfalls and ensuring that the finished result meets your expectations.

Installing tiles correctly is crucial to ensuring they last and look good. Here’s a quick guide on how tiles are installed:
Ensure the surface is smooth, clean, and dry. Any unevenness can lead to issues down the line.
Measure the space and cut the tiles to fit. Use tile spacers to ensure even gaps between tiles.
Use thin-set cement or tile adhesive to secure the tiles. Place the tiles carefully, pressing them firmly into place.
Once the adhesive is dry, apply grout to fill the gaps between tiles. Wipe off any excess grout to leave a clean finish.
Sealing the tiles is essential to protect them from water and stains, especially in wet areas like bathrooms and kitchens.
